Skip to content

⁠ Certain Anomaly psychic rituals not working in multiplayer ⁠ #855

@jcs-png

Description

@jcs-png

Description
When performing the Draw Animals, Void Provocation or Draw Shamblers psychic rituals in multiplayer, the ritual completes (bioferrite is consumed, cooldown is applied) but nothing ever spawns on the map. Notification appears but nothing happens. Draw Fleshbeasts works correctly.

Have not tested other rituals, but these have been tested multiple times.

Steps to reproduce
1.⁠ ⁠Host a multiplayer session with at least one other player
2.⁠ ⁠Research and perform the Draw Animals or Draw Shamblers ritual
3.⁠ ⁠Ritual animation completes, bioferrite is consumed, cooldown begins
4.⁠ ⁠Notification appears appears, nothing spawns on the map

Expected behaviour
Animals or shamblers should spawn on the map after the ritual completes.

Actual behaviour
Nothing spawns. The ritual silently fails.

Error from log

PsychicRitualToil Verse.AI.Group.PsychicRitualToil_InvokeHorax threw an exception during Start(): System.InvalidOperationException: Collection was modified; enumeration operation may not execute.
at System.Collections.Generic.List1+Enumerator[T].MoveNextRare () at System.Collections.Generic.List1+Enumerator[T].MoveNext ()
at Verse.AI.Group.PsychicRitualToil_InvokeHorax.HoldRequiredOfferings
at Verse.AI.Group.PsychicRitualToil_InvokeHorax.Start
at Verse.AI.Group.PsychicRitualToilRunner.Start

RimWorld version: 1.6.4633 rev1269

Multiplayer mod version: v0.11.0tacb33a2
I'm aware there is a newer version of the multiplayer mod available but it is currently not working on Mac, so we are running an older version.
NOTE: Latest v0.11.4 does NOT work at all on Mac

Mod list:

1.6.4633 rev1269
  • zetrith.prepatcher
  • ludeon.rimworld
  • ludeon.rimworld.royalty
  • ludeon.rimworld.ideology
  • ludeon.rimworld.biotech
  • ludeon.rimworld.anomaly
  • ludeon.rimworld.odyssey
  • rwmt.multiplayer
  • rwmt.multiplayercompatibility
  • adaptive.storage.framework
  • oskarpotocki.vanillafactionsexpanded.core
  • vanillaexpanded.vappe
  • vanillaexpanded.varme
  • sarg.alphaanimals
  • sarg.alphamechs
  • vanillaexpanded.vtexe
  • vanillaexpanded.vwe
  • edb.preparecarefully
  • dubwise.dubsmintmenus
  • brrainz.cameraplus
  • crashm.colorcodedmoodbar.11
  • spincrus.dinosauria
  • albion.goexplore
  • telefonmast.graphicssettings
  • krafs.levelup
  • spino.megafauna
  • bp.showbuildablematerialcount
  • co.uk.epicguru.whatsthatmod
  • nandonalt.snowytrees
  • mlie.alphamuffalo
  • oskarpotocki.vfe.medieval2
  • oskarpotocki.vfe.pirates
  • oskarpotocki.vanillafactionsexpanded.settlersmodule
  • orion.hospitality
  • gy.urav
  • ludeon.rimworld.royalty
  • ludeon.rimworld.ideology
  • ludeon.rimworld.biotech
  • ludeon.rimworld.anomaly
  • ludeon.rimworld.odyssey
  • Attached: Full log
    log-rim.txt

    Metadata

    Metadata

    Assignees

    No one assigned

      Labels

      No labels
      No labels

      Type

      No type

      Projects

      No projects

      Milestone

      No milestone

      Relationships

      None yet

      Development

      No branches or pull requests

      Issue actions